As the actors strike approaches the end of its first week in Hollywood, one show currently in production will go on.

While A-list stars, including Tom Cruise, have had to walk away from their sets after the strike was announced July 13, The Chosen has received permission to proceed.

The show, which focuses on the ministry of Jesus and his disciples, announced it had worked out a deal with SAG-AFTRA to continue production on season four of the Bible-based drama.

The set, located in Utah, was shut down after the strike was called, but series creator Dallas Jenkins, applied for a waver from the union and was granted one.

The director announced the news Sunday via social media.
